Dr. Jessica Baker, DAcHM
Dr. Jessica Baker, DAcHM is a Doctor of Acupuncture and Herbal Medicine, Farmer, and Educator. Her knowledge of integrative medicine is reflected in her clinical practice, formulations, and classes on aromatherapy, herbalism, and Chinese medicine.
Jessica has been an avid reader and writer since she was a young child. Growing up in a military family and living in Germany as a teenager fueled her passion for different cultures. As an undergrad at the University of Georgia she studied Classical Literature and Greek, and developed a love for languages and ancient cultures. She joined the UGA chapter of Cannabis Action Network and her advocacy for cannabis began. In 1997, she left university and moved to the redwood coast of northern California.
Her herbal journey began at the Dandelion Herbal Center with Jane Bothwell in 1998. In 2001, she had the opportunity to complete a Community Herbalist Certification Program with renowned herbalist Dr. Christopher Hobbs, where she was introduced to Traditional Chinese Medicine diagnostic techniques, classical Chinese theory, and herbs.
Her time with Dr. Hobbs inspired her to study Chinese Medicine at Five Branches University in Santa Cruz, CA, where she received a Master’s Degree in Traditional Chinese Medicine in 2008. At Five Branches, she also became a Certified Medical Qi Gong practitioner. She holds a Diplomat in Acupuncture and Herbal Medicine through the National Certification Board for Acupuncture and Herbal Medicine. In 2026, she received her Doctorate of Acupuncture and Chinese Medicine from her alma mater, Five Branches University.
Jessica has studied Medical Aromatherapy through the Pacific Institute of Aromatherapy and with Daoist master Jeffrey Yuen. She is a certified Acudetox Specialist (ADS) through the National Acupuncture Detoxification Association and has worked extensively with veterans and others with PTSd. In 2008, she opened Jade Dragon Acupuncture, a medical spa in Arcata, CA and co-founded the Humboldt Veterans Acupuncture Project provide free acupuncture to military persons with PTSD.
With over two decades of clinical experience, Jessica is a talented formulator, understanding the importance of how biochemistry interacts with plant constituents and energetics. Her expertise in medical cannabis cultivation and breeding, extraction, and formulation has given her the opportunity to assist in the formulation of herbal and cannabis products for large and small businesses. As an educator teaches at several herbal symposia and acupuncture conferences throughout the United States. Jessica is on the faculty of the Holistic Cannabis Academy and has taught at The Colorado School of Clinical Herbalism since 2016. She continues to offer online and in person classes and is available for guest lecturing.
Publications include articles in The International Journal of Professional Holistic Aromatherapists, Cannabis Nurses Journal, CannaHealth, AromaCulture, and Eden Magazine. Her first book, Plant Songs: Reflections on Herbal Medicine is available online and at some booksellers.
